Westland, Indiana

Westland is an unincorporated community in Blue River Township, Hancock County, in the U.S. state of Indiana.

[2] The community received its name from the Westland Friends Church, which was established in the area in 1840.

It was too far to travel to church on a regular basis so a new Meeting was established in the land west of Walnut Ridge.

[3] A post office was established at Westland in 1845, and remained in operation until it was discontinued in 1905.
